Conducting Keyword Research
The first step in optimizing your Amazon and Walmart listings is conducting keyword research. This involves identifying the keywords and phrases that your target audience is searching for when looking for products like yours. By incorporating these keywords into your product listings, you’ll increase the likelihood that your products will appear in relevant search results.
One way to conduct keyword research is by using a tool like Google Keyword Planner or Ahrefs. These tools allow you to enter a keyword related to your product and see a list of related keywords and their search volumes. You can then select the most relevant keywords and incorporate them into your product titles, bullet points, and descriptions.
Another way to conduct keyword research is by looking at the search terms that customers are using to find your products. On Amazon, you can do this by going to the “Search Terms” report in your Seller Central account. This report will show you the search terms that customers are using to find your products, allowing you to identify any keywords that you may be missing and incorporate them into your listings.
